Spring.NET 1.3.0 RC1 for .NET 2.0 API Reference

AbstractResource.Exists Property

Does this resource actually exist in physical form?

[Visual Basic]
Public Overridable ReadOnly Property Exists() As Boolean _
    Implements IResource.Exists

   Public Get
   End Get
End Property
[C#]
public virtual bool Exists { public get; }

Property Value

true if this resource actually exists in physical form (for example on a filesystem).

Implements

IResource.Exists

Remarks

This implementation checks whether a FileInfo can be opened, falling back to whether a Stream can be opened.

This will cover both directories and content resources.

This implementation will also return false if permission to the (file's) path is denied.

See Also

AbstractResource Class | Spring.Core.IO Namespace | Exists | File